Abstract

The invention mainly aims to provide a method, a system and a clock board for transmitting synchronous status message. The method comprises that the clock board sends the synchronous status message to a service board in an Ethernet message switching mode. The method, the system and the clock board are simple to implement and reduce the maintenance cost.

Background technology
In synchronous digital communications network (SDH/SONET), Synchronization Status Message (SSM) is the important assurance that clock unit is realized clock networking protection, and the protection in clock source is switched by SSM and realized.And transmit SSM between clock board and business board in real time is that the important step of protecting with the clock networking is switched in the clock source protection; whether what it directly influenced the phase-locked loop tracking is high-quality clock signal and networking defencive function; and then influence the clock signal situation of whole networking and whole SDH network operate as normal.
The inventor finds that present technology transmits SSM information by the hardware controls mode between clock board and business board, realizes complexity, and integrated level is low, reliability is low.

Embodiment
Need to prove that under the situation of not conflicting, embodiment and the feature among the embodiment among the application can make up mutually.Describe the present invention below with reference to the accompanying drawings and in conjunction with the embodiments in detail.
According to embodiments of the invention, a kind of method of transmitting synchronous status message is provided, comprising: clock board sends Synchronization Status Message by the Ethernet message switching scheme to business board.
In correlation technique, between clock board and business board, transmit SSM information by the hardware controls mode.Present embodiment is because send Synchronization Status Message by the Ethernet message switching scheme to business board, and this is a kind of software control method, so realize simply having reduced production and maintenance cost.
Preferably, clock board uses existing ethernet channel between clock board and the business board sharedly, sends SSM information by the Ethernet message switching scheme to business board.In correlation technique, between clock board and business board, transmit SSM information, and in the present embodiment,, share existing ethernet channel so can communicate by letter with other because employing is the Ethernet message switching scheme by the hardware controls mode.Because need not newly-built hardware corridor,, production and the maintenance cost of transmitting SSM have been saved so can improve integrated level.
Fig. 1 is the flow chart of the method for transmitting synchronous status message according to the preferred embodiment of the invention, and clock board sends Synchronization Status Message by the Ethernet message switching scheme to business board and comprises:
Step S102, judge whether clock board following at least a incident takes place: the system clock credit rating of clock board changes; Protection takes place in the clock source of clock board switches; Clock board receives the notice that business board starts; Clock board receives webmaster and forces to send the SSM notification of information;
Step S104 is if then clock board sends Synchronization Status Message to business board.
Communication or cry the communication of S mouth between plate is between veneer and the veneer, and transmission system internal data between NCP and the veneer does not have mutual communication with webmaster.If in order to transmit SSM in real time between clock board and business board, transmit SSM as far as possible continually, this frequent communication might cause the communication of S mouth to be blocked.Present embodiment just transmits SSM information under the situation that particular event drives, this can guarantee the real-time that SSM information is transmitted, and can reduce the traffic again, thus solved that the real-time that transmits SSM requires and channel pressure between the problem of generation contradiction.
Preferably, also judge whether to reach the transmission cycle, if then clock board sends SSM information to business board.Real-time in order to guarantee that SSM information is transmitted in the correlation technique, and transmit SSM information as far as possible continually.And in the present embodiment,, can be provided with greatlyyer so periodically send the cycle of SSM information because reasonably be provided with the trigger event that transmits SSM information, to reduce the traffic, avoid influencing other S port communications.
Preferably, clock board judges whether the system clock credit rating of clock board changes earlier, whether the clock source of judging clock board then protection takes place is switched, judge then whether clock board receives the notice that business board starts, judge then whether clock board receives webmaster and force to send the SSM notification of information, judges whether to have arrived the transmission cycle then; In the process that order is judged, in case judge establishment, the determining step after then ignoring is directly carried out clock board sends step from SSM information to business board.
Fig. 2 is according to the flow chart of the method for the transmitting synchronous status message of the preferred embodiment, comprises the steps:
Step S201, after the generation incident, whether decision event if change step S205, otherwise changes step S202 for the system clock credit rating changes.
Detect current system clock in this step, do not cause that the clock source protection switches if the change of credit rating just takes place system clock, then mark triggers is transmitted the flag bit of SSM information, carries out the step that sends SSM information.
Step S202, whether decision event switches for protection takes place in the clock source, if change step S205 over to, otherwise changes step S203 over to.
Owing to alarm is lost in the power supply input, credit rating changes, forces reasons such as switching timing source, cause the present clock source that protection takes place and switch in this step, then mark triggers is transmitted the flag bit of SSM information, carries out the step that sends SSM information.
Step S203, whether decision event is the notice after business board starts, if change step S205 over to, otherwise changes step S204 over to.
Owing to increase the insertion business board newly, perhaps restart reasons such as existing business board, the agreement business board need transmit current SSM information by specific format (as the message of interior Wen Weiquan 0) the notice clock veneer that sends the SSM infomational message and give business board after entering normal operating condition.If this special packet is received and resolved to the clock veneer, then mark triggers is transmitted the flag bit of SSM information, carries out the step that sends SSM information.
Step S204, whether decision event is that webmaster is forced to send the SSM notification of information, if change step S205 over to, otherwise gets back to step S201 again.
Because webmaster is forced certain port of certain business board is forced to send specific SSM information, if the clock veneer is received and resolved correctly, then mark triggers is transmitted the flag bit of SSM information, carries out the step that sends SSM information in this step.
Step S205 sends current SSM information.Present embodiment to all current SSM of business board broadcast transmission on the throne, continues execution in step S201-S205 after receiving incident with the form of multicast.
Detect each business board situation on the throne in this step, and,, write message with the multicast form with reference to message specification according to the situation that the SSM information and the webmaster of current system clock source force to transmit SSM information, and to the current SSM information of all business board broadcast transmissions on the throne.
Above step S201 forms an implementation to step S205.Present embodiment adopts above-mentioned judgement order, but the present invention is not limited to this, and clock board also can adopt the order that is different from above-mentioned order to judge to the incident that receives.
Step S206, whether the timing of timed sending SSM information arrives, if change step S207 over to.
The concrete condition that sends according to the message of S mouth communication in this step, other of the communication between plate of staggering be the transmission cycle of Ethernet message periodically, avoids crossing swords with them, selects the regularly cycle of circulating transfer SSM information, is 11 minutes and 11 seconds as selection cycle., the timing of timing cycle transmission SSM information carries out the step that sends SSM information if arriving.
Step S207 sends current SSM information, and restarts timer, gets back to step S206.Present embodiment with the form of multicast to all current SSM of business board broadcast transmission on the throne.
Detect each business board situation on the throne in this step, and,, write message with the multicast form with reference to message specification according to the situation that the SSM information and the webmaster of current system clock source force to transmit SSM information, and to the current SSM information of all business board broadcast transmissions on the throne.
In addition, step S206-S207 forms a circulation, above step S201 is the relation that walks abreast to the implementation of step S205 formation and the circulation of step S206-S207, promptly no matter whether step S201 carries out step S205 to the implementation that step S205 forms, the circulation of step S206-S207 all will be carried out independently, and constantly circulation is gone down.
Need to prove, can in computer system, carry out in the step shown in the flow chart of accompanying drawing such as a set of computer-executable instructions, and, though there is shown logical order in flow process, but can carry out in some cases, with the order execution step shown or that describe that is different from herein.
Preferably, the transmission cycle is set to asynchronous with other cycles of communicating by letter of sharing ethernet channel.This can reduce the pressure of communication between plate, reduces the possibility of blocking.
Preferably, clock board sends SSM information by the multicast mode to a plurality of business boards.Correlation technique is to adopt point-to-point message mode to transmit SSM information, compares with point-to-point message mode, thereby guarantees the real-time of the SSM information synchronization of each business board and clock board better.
The embodiment of the invention provides a kind of clock board, comprising: sending module is used for sending Synchronization Status Message by the Ethernet message switching scheme to business board.
In correlation technique, between clock board and business board, set up special hardware line to transmit SSM information, this belongs to a kind of hardware controls mode.Present embodiment is because send Synchronization Status Message by the Ethernet message switching scheme to business board, and this is a kind of software control method, so realize simply can improving integrated level, has reduced maintenance cost.
Fig. 3 is the schematic diagram of clock board according to the preferred embodiment of the invention, comprising:
Judge module 10, be used to judge whether clock board following at least a incident takes place: the system clock credit rating of clock board changes; Protection takes place in the clock source of clock board switches; Clock board receives the notice that business board starts; Clock board receives the notice that webmaster forces to send Synchronization Status Message;
Sending module 20 is used for judge module and is judged as when being, sends Synchronization Status Message to business board.
Preferably, sending module uses existing ethernet channel between clock board and the business board sharedly, sends Synchronization Status Message by the Ethernet message switching scheme to business board.
Preferably, judge module also judges whether to reach the transmission cycle, and sending module is judged as when being at judge module, sends Synchronization Status Message to business board, and wherein, the transmission cycle is asynchronous with other cycles of communicating by letter of shared ethernet channel.
Embodiments of the invention also provide a kind of system of transmitting synchronous status message, comprising: the clock board of business board and above-mentioned arbitrary embodiment.
Fig. 4 is the schematic diagram of the system of transmitting synchronous status message according to the preferred embodiment of the invention, comprising: clock board 1 has the passage of transmitting synchronous status message; Business board 2 connects with clock board 1, transmitting synchronous status message, and wherein, clock board 1 connects with a plurality of business boards 2, and by the form broadcast transmission Synchronization Status Message of Ethernet message switching scheme realization with multicast.
Because many large-scale communication apparatus, its professional groove position has about 40, each groove position is no less than two ports, present embodiment adopts multicast proforma message broadcast transmission mode can also improve first groove position business board and last groove position business board obtains the simultaneity of current SSM information, thereby guarantees the real-time of the SSM information synchronization of each business board and clock board better.
From above description, as can be seen, the present invention has realized following technique effect: just transmit SSM information under the situation that particular event drives, this can guarantee the real-time that SSM information is transmitted, can reduce the traffic again, thus solved that the real-time of the transmission SSM of correlation technique requires and channel pressure between produce the problem of contradiction.
